Department and Role: The Hogan Lovells disputes practice in London is market-leading, recognised as a "Band 1" practice by both Chambers & Partners and Legal 500 across multiple categories, including Commercial and Corporate Litigation, Fraud: Civil and Product Liability: Mainly Defendant. Our clients span a wide range of industry sectors and geographies, and we advise on a wide range of disputes, which extend from investigations through litigation to arbitration and employment disputes. Invariably, these cases are complex, high value and often cross-border in nature. A feature of many of these cases is the need for us to assist and advise our clients on preserving, collecting, processing, reviewing, and disclosing large volumes of documents. As a result, we are looking to recruit a Senior Knowledge Lawyer to provide dedicated, specialist support to the practice when handling all aspects of the disclosure lifecycle.

The role will be a dynamic one, with significant scope for self-starting and initiative. It will involve working across teams and in a wide variety of contexts, but the focus will be the conduct of substantial document retrieval and review exercises, which will often but not always conclude with a disclosure process.

The role will involve a combination of:

  • Subject matter expertise: acquiring, staying up to date with, and then bringing to bear specialist knowledge of all the facets of the disclosure process and disclosure "best practice";
  • Support on client matters: supporting individual case/client teams by providing assistance and project management support as necessary throughout the disclosure process;
  • Knowledge management: ensuring that experience and expertise is centrally maintained and accessible by all members of the practice.

The role would particularly suit an experienced disputes lawyer looking for a new challenge combining a knowledge/professional support lawyer role with the opportunity to continue to contribute to client work.
